这个文档是全英文可能看起来会比较吃力,但是技术文档还是要看原版的,有兴趣的可以尝试看看。
![图片[1]-【PDF】A Byte of Python原版全英文文档非扫描版-分贝虎-免费网站源码_免费软件_免费精品资源分享平台!](https://www.dbhoo.com/wp-content/uploads/2025/12/image-29.png)
《A Byte of Python》(常译作《Python 一瞥》/《Python 编程快速上手》)是由 Swaroop C H 编写的经典 Python 零基础入门开源书籍,以 “短小精悍、通俗易懂、实战导向” 著称,是全球数百万初学者的首选入门资料之一。以下是关于这本书的核心信息和学习指南:
一、书籍核心定位
- 免费开源:全书无版权限制,可在官方网站免费下载中英文版(适配 Python 3.x,已摒弃 2.x 兼容内容),也支持在线阅读。
- 轻量高效:全书仅百余页,聚焦 Python 核心基础,无冗余理论,适合 “快速建立 Python 知识框架”。
- 零基础友好:从 “环境搭建” 到 “实战小脚本”,步骤拆解清晰,示例简单易懂,无需编程前置知识。
二、核心内容框架
| 模块 | 关键知识点 |
|---|---|
| 基础准备 | Python 环境搭建(Windows/macOS/Linux)、解释器 / IDLE 使用、第一个 Python 程序 |
| 核心语法 | 变量 / 数据类型、运算符、条件判断(if-else)、循环(for/while)、注释规范 |
| 容器类型 | 列表、元组、字典、集合(创建 / 增删改查 / 常用方法) |
| 函数与模块化 | 函数定义 / 调用、参数(位置 / 关键字 / 默认)、lambda、模块 / 包导入 |
| 面向对象(OOP) | 类 / 对象定义、属性 / 方法、继承 / 多态、构造函数(init) |
| 实用技能 | 异常处理(try-except)、文件 I/O、简单调试技巧 |
| 实战示例 | 计算器、文件批量处理、简单文本分析等小脚本 |
三、适合人群
- 零基础想入门 Python 的新手(学生、转行人员、业余爱好者);
- 想快速掌握 Python 核心语法,拒绝冗长理论的学习者;
- 需一本轻量化参考手册,随时查阅基础知识点的开发者。
四、高效学习建议
- 敲代码而非 “看代码”:书中示例均短小易懂,手动敲一遍(而非复制),能快速理解语法细节;
- 边学边练:每学完一个章节,尝试修改示例代码(比如给循环加条件、给函数加参数),验证自己的理解;
- 落地小项目:学完核心内容后,用书中知识点实现简单需求(比如 “统计文本中单词出现次数”“批量重命名文件夹里的文件”);
- 版本适配:优先用 Python 3.8+ 版本(书中已适配 3.x),避免 2.x 的语法差异(如 print 函数、编码等);
- 补充进阶内容:这本书仅覆盖基础,后续可根据方向(数据分析 / 爬虫 / 后端)补充 Pandas、Scrapy、Django 等内容。
五、补充资源
- 官方中文版:https://python.swaroopch.com/zh_cn/(可直接在线阅读,也可下载 PDF/EPUB);
- 配套练习:结合 LeetCode 简单题(如 “两数之和”“字符串反转”)巩固语法;
- 中文社区解读:B 站 / 知乎有不少基于这本书的入门讲解视频,可辅助理解。
© 版权声明
本站资源所有权归原作者所有,我们仅提供用于学习和测试,不得用于商业行为,如有违反后果自负与本站无关,本站内容为原创内容未经允许请勿转载。本站解压密码为www.dbhoo.com
THE END












